Transaction 344ec23db140296d147f633f1220ad0e979c7d28681e135524ee3afbb13365ef
1 Input
1 Output
-
344ec23db140296d147f633f1220ad0e979c7d28681e135524ee3afbb13365ef:0
- value
- 3228820
- script pubkey
- OP_0 OP_PUSHBYTES_20 d4d56ddee1bfd8cdc7c8c7527333110b8690f125
- address
- bc1q6n2kmhhphlvvm37gcaf8xvc3pwrfpuf93wqpl0